Transaction 6a036e318a3d60a1a7a4924133aaf4ff874cb5c8ad4602200116726f8a8fcba9

block
f1727b6954c10870406a51ea996996764d9ef571c4e21b9b061784a85b913860

1 Input

23 Outputs